While The Seducer's Diary is a work of non-fiction, great 19th century philosopher Soren Kierkegaard often writes like a novelist. His philosophical points made under guises, where he takes on multiple personalities and perspectives. "The Seducer's Diary" is one of the most fascinating chapters of Kierkegaard's Either/Or. It is the culmination of Kierkegaard's portrayal of the "aesthetic" life, and reveals very clearly some of the horrific failings of "student A" and his world-view/5(43). "In the vast literature of love, The Seducer's Diary is an intricate curiosity--a feverishly intellectual attempt to reconstruct an erotic failure as a pedagogic success, a wound masked as a boast," observes John Updike in his foreword to Søren Kierkegaard's narrative. This work, a chapter from Kierkegaard's first major volume, Either/Or, springs from his relationship with his fiancée, Regine Olsen. Overview.
